A research assessing lover reception of VAR within the Premier League was produced by Otto Kolbinger and Melanie Knopp and was finished by analysing Twitter knowledge.[ninety three] The researchers made use of sentiment Assessment to evaluate the general constructive or damaging attitudes in the direction of VAR, together with subject modelling to recognize certain problems that enthusiasts are talking about associated with VAR. The review uncovered the reception of VAR on Twitter is essentially negative, with followers expressing frustration and criticism of the know-how's influence on the flow of the game as well as inconsistency of decisions.

Throughout the nineteen eighties, big English clubs had begun to rework into business enterprise ventures, making use of business rules to club administration to maximize revenue. Martin Edwards of Manchester United, Irving Scholar of Tottenham Hotspur, and David Dein of Arsenal were being One of the leaders in this transformation.[22] The business crucial resulted in the top clubs searching for to get more info raise their ability and revenue: the clubs in Division A person threatened to break away from the Football League, As well as in doing so, they managed to increase their voting energy and gain a more favorable monetary arrangement, having a fifty% share of all tv and sponsorship earnings in 1986.[22] They demanded that television providers really should pay out much more for his or her protection of football matches,[23] and revenue from television grew in importance. The Football League received £6.three million for any two-calendar year arrangement in 1986, but by 1988, inside of a deal agreed with ITV, the cost rose to £44 million around four several years, Using the primary clubs taking 75% from the dollars.

'Homegrown' implies the player need to be English - but in reality it is a player of any nationality that has used at the least a few seasons coaching at an experienced English or Welsh club prior to the age of 21.

 Cristiano Ronaldo getting ready to take a free of charge kick inside a 2009 match between Manchester United and Liverpool The Television set rights arrangement between the Premier League and Sky confronted accusations of becoming a cartel, and many courtroom scenarios arose Consequently.[169] An investigation via the Place of work of Good Investing in 2002 observed BSkyB to be dominant in the pay back Tv set sports activities market, but concluded that there were insufficient grounds with the declare that BSkyB had abused its dominant place.
